2016-05-23 2 views
0

エクセルからテーブルをインポートしてtblDataという名前のテーブルにアクセスしましたが、すでにtblAccという名前のテーブルがあり、tblDataからtblAccにレコードを移動する必要があります。問題は、フィールドが同じ順序でないことです。再コラムまたはコピーコラム

例: tblData:

PARTNAME NUMBER COST 
JK15  251 55 

とtblAccで:

PARTNAME COST NUMBER 
CH61  14  6 

それでは、どのように私は、列でテーブル列にテーブルから転送することができますまたはどのように私はtblData内の列を並べ替えることができますか?

答えて

1

あるテーブルから別のテーブルにデータを移動する最も簡単な方法は、AccessがAppendクエリを呼び出すものを構築することです。

クエリビルダを使用すると、フィールドが正しくマップされ、そのようにデータをロードできます。このような

SQLの何かが、あまりにも、動作するはずです:

INSERT INTO tblAcc (PARTNAME, COST, NUMBER) 
SELECT PARTNAME, COST, NUMBER 
    FROM tblData; 
関連する問題